steal the night 

To "Steal the night" seems to be an expression that means having a great evening with a man or woman you might love.

This term was used in a popular scene in the movie Bloodsport (1988), but also appears in many more popular songs (i.e., Lookbook - Steal the Night).

Shackteâu

A Shackteau is a humble, weather-beaten, structurally questionable shelter located in a spectacular or highly coveted place—Wales, Jackson Hole, Sun Valley, Crested Butte, coastal Maine, the Alps—where the building itself may be worth almost nothing, but the dirt, view, access, and mythology make it absurdly valuable.
In use:
Shackteâu - We thought it was an abandoned shed until the realtor called it a rare alpine Shackteâu with unobstructed views and listed it for $2 million.
